Had a couple of codes come up going up long stretch of hill going about 75 mph ....Bronco went into limited power mode.

Took to dealer and results came in and fixed.

the Charge Air Cooler Hose was barely attached to the Charge Air Cooler Pipe..so it was basically sucking air.

Good news is I thought the Bronco had really great power, but now that I have full boost...wow!

Can’t wait to see if it helps on miles per gallon.

Can you describe where the Charge Air Cooler Hose and Pipe are? Maybe take a pic? Is it easily accessible; can we find this issue during delivery acceptance?
The intake lines (blue) take in outside air and run it to the turbos. The turbos then charge, or compress, the air and feed it into the charge air lines (red). These lines run to the intercooler (yellow), which cools the charge air, then from the intercooler to the intake.

The intercooler is up front directly behind the front bumper. My bet is that's likely where the bad connection was given the other portions of the charge pipes are move visible.
